Pricing and Rates of Registered Agent Services
When considering registered agent services, grasping the costs and fees involved is vital for business owners. Registered agent companies usually charge yearly charges, which can differ significantly based on the extent of service available. While you might find cheap registered agent services starting around the low end of the pricing spectrum, premium providers that offer additional benefits such as compliance reminders and mail handling may charge higher rates. An average budget for trustworthy registered agent services spans 100 to 300 dollars each year, but it is critical to assess what is provided with that fee.
In also to the base recurring fee, be aware of potential extra charges. Some registered agent providers require fees for particular offerings such as document forwarding, additional business mail handling, or annual compliance filings. If you're evaluating a nationwide registered agent, expenses may change based on the states in which they conduct business, as some states have specific registered agent requirements that could affect the overall pricing. Requirements for Registered Agents
To function as a registered agent, individuals or organizations must meet particular legislative requirements set by every state. Typically, the designated representative must be a resident of the jurisdiction in which the company is established or a business entity licensed to conduct commerce in that area. This ensures that there is a reliable point of contact for legal documents and notifications related to the business.
Another vital requirement is accessibility during standard operating hours. Registered agents must be available to receive service of process and additional important documents. This means they should maintain regular office hours and have a physical address for the receipt of official documents. Having a registered office ensures compliance with various statutory obligations.
Moreover, designated agents are expected to provide specific services, such as forwarding court papers to the business and notifying the enterprise of key deadlines, like annual compliance filings. Changing Your Registered Agent
Changing your designated agent is an important step for business owners who need to ensure compliance with state regulations or need different service features. To initiate the process, you must first choose a new designated agent company that meets your needs, taking into account aspects such as reliability, availability, and compliance with designated agent requirements. Ensure to evaluate the top registered agent options available and choose one that fits your business structure, whether it's an LLC or incorporation.
Once you have selected a new registered agent provider, you will need to submit the required paperwork to formally designate them as your designated agent. This usually requires completing a registered agent modification form and sending it to your state’s Secretary of State or relevant authority. Be aware of any associated registered agent charges and confirm that your new agent is ready to carry out the responsibilities of service of process, including handling legal documents and adherence reminders.
Once the paperwork is submitted, verify that your registered agent change has been processed and that your new agent is registered with the correct state agency. It is also good practice to inform your previous registered agent about the change and ensure that they have forwarded any pending legal documents or correspondence. Doing so helps preserve continuity in your business entity and prevents any interruptions in receiving critical legal communications.
